Explosive Allegations Made by Virginia Giuffre Against Jeffrey Epstein and Ghislaine Maxwell
Virginia Giuffre, a key figure in the Jeffrey Epstein scandal, recently made shocking allegations against the late financier and his alleged accomplice, Ghislaine Maxwell. In her testimony, Giuffre detailed the disturbing events that took place while she was in Epstein’s employment.
According to Giuffre, two weeks after she started working for Epstein, he made a sinister proposition. He asked her to quit her job and work for him full-time, with the condition that she would be at his beck and call day and night. Feeling hesitant about the offer, Epstein allegedly used a manipulative tactic by showing her a photo of her little brother and hinting that he had information about his whereabouts. Giuffre claimed that Epstein implied he had control over the Palm Beach police department and that she should never disclose what happened in his house.
Moreover, Giuffre accused Maxwell, Epstein’s former associate, of playing a significant role in facilitating his illicit activities. Not only did Maxwell allegedly recruit young girls for Epstein’s sexual encounters, but she also participated in the sessions herself. Giuffre claimed that she was often instructed to attend to Maxwell sexually when she was present, and that Maxwell kept a bin of sex toys for such purposes. However, Giuffre clarified that Maxwell never demanded sexual favors from her in private, only when they were with Epstein.
